Our Story

Providence Care is situated on the traditional lands of the Haudenosaunee and Anishinaabe People.

Providence Care is Southeastern Ontario’s leading provider of specialized care in aging, mental health and rehabilitation.

Continuing the legacy of our Founders, the Sisters of Providence of St. Vincent de Paul, Providence Care consists of Providence Care Hospital, Providence Transitional Care Centre, Providence Manor long-term care home, Hospice Kingston, and more than 22 community based mental health and support services across the region. 

Fully-affiliated with Queen’s University and St. Lawrence College, Providence Care is a member of the Ontario Hospital Association, and is a centre for healthcare, education and research. We are more than healthcare; we promote independence, enhance quality of life and redefine traditional healthcare through partnerships, innovation and research.

Catholic Health Care Provider

Providence Care belongs to a system of 21 Catholic health care providers across Ontario, sponsored by the Catholic Health Sponsors Ontario (CHSO). The sponsored Organizations were established by seven Congregations of religious Sisters. The Sisters were health care pioneers who created a culture of excellence, compassion, respect and inclusion that is still relevant today.

As sponsor, CHSO continues the legacy of the Sisters of Providence of St. Vincent de Paul by ensuring that the Catholic identity, Mission and Values, strengthen and enrich health care delivery in our province.
